The Dodgers enter this three-game series at home with a strong 69-46 record and significant advantages in roster depth and recent offensive production, highlighted by Shohei Ohtani's multi-homer performances. Los Angeles faces some pitching absences, including Blake Snell and Tyler Glasnow on the 60-day IL, while Freddie Freeman deals with a day-to-day hand issue, but the club maintains a competitive rotation and bullpen. The Royals sit at 48-67 with multiple key contributors sidelined, such as Vinnie Pasquantino and Maikel Garcia on the 10-day IL plus several longer-term absences impacting their lineup and relief options. Home/away splits and the Dodgers' stronger overall form shape trader consensus around the higher-probability outcome for Los Angeles across the series.

This market will resolve to "Kansas City Royals" if the Kansas City Royals win the game.
This market will resolve to "Los Angeles Dodgers" if the Los Angeles Dodgers win the game.
If the game is postponed, this market will remain open until the game has been completed. If the game is canceled entirely, with no make-up game, or ends in a tie, this market will resolve 50-50.
The primary resolution source for this market is the official final statistics of the event as recognized by the governing body or event organizers. However, if the governing body or event organizers have not published final match statistics within 24 hours after the event's conclusion, a consensus of credible reporting may be used instead.
